Leave a comment

Comments 2

mzsparkles June 11 2009, 13:26:24 UTC
Ah man, and just when I had finally managed to get that Istanbul song out of my head.
Damn you!! XD

Reply

lavendergaia June 11 2009, 13:39:38 UTC
They Might Be Giants own all. You can never escape!!

Reply


Leave a comment

Up